Output 273aba4a508bfe5db9a498c1b21d11f5789fdb1854a92b44a53327f5a4847b07:0

value
24876259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d878da51343c7daf1ae4d11b925d3201f979ba0a OP_EQUAL
address
3MRceyjZovTjZQ9mU1sQVMhpQZG2aJi6zL
transaction
273aba4a508bfe5db9a498c1b21d11f5789fdb1854a92b44a53327f5a4847b07
spent
true